Maelstrom
Gunpowder Games
PC/Steam

Pirates? Check. Awesome naval battles? Check. Intense Battle Royale that doesn’t suck? Check! As we mentioned in our original article about Maelstrom, this is definitely a hidden gem in the massive library of Steam free to play games. Honestly, it’s one of the better surprises to come across out desks in a very long time. Anyone remotely interested in the items mentioned should check this out ASAP. With tons of content and plenty more on the way, Maelstrom has an incredibly bright future. Paid content has some awesome Wraith and Dread content that is completely optional but well worth the investment.

Path of Exile: Delirium
Grinding Gear Games
PC/Xbox One/PS4

I’m happy to see more and more ARPGs are gaining popularity but not many can hold a candle to Path of Exile. With the latest Delirium patch, the world of Wraeclast has never been more intriguing. The game is like a fine wine that gets better and better with age. Whether you are interested in loot based ARPGs or not, Path of Exile is definitely worth your time. Paid content is cosmetic only.

Call of Duty: Warzone
Infinity Ward/Raven Software
PC/Xbox One/PS4 (Crossplay)

Ok ok. So you don’t care for Call of Duty but you want a super high quality free to play game? Trust me, try Warzone. This is coming from a person who tired of the series long ago but don’t take my word for it, give it a try this weekend, it’s stunning that it’s free. Also, if you tired of the same ol’ Battle Royale, try Plunder mode with a group of friends, it’s an absolutely riot.
